BRP slum fire under control

A fire has broken out at the BRP slum in the capital's Bhashantek area.

Five firefighting units from Mirpur and Kurmitola fire stations are currently working to control the blaze, according to Fire Service and Civil Defence officials.

The fire was first reported at around 11am on Thursday (6 March), said Talha Bin Zasim, station officer (media cell) of the Fire Service and Civil Defence headquarters.

Fire Service officials later confirmed that the flames were brought under control at around 11:35am.

Details regarding how the fire started or the extent of damage are yet to be known.

No casualties have been reported so far.

Police and army personnel are at the scene to help the firefighters and keep the situation around the slum under control.
